Package: qemu
Version: 0.9.1-10lenny1
Severity: minor

        Despite claiming to be compatible, 

--cut: qemu-img(1) --
           "cow"
               User Mode Linux Copy On Write image format. Used to be the only
               growable image format in QEMU. It is supported only for
               compatibility with previous versions. It does not work on
               win32.
--cut: qemu-img(1) --

        qemu-img(1) fails to actually support the .cow files produced by
        uml_mkcow(1), at least on amd64:

$ qemu-img info 1255869863.cow
image: 1255869863.cow
file format: raw
virtual size: 4.0G (4296024064 bytes)
disk size: 3.6G
$ qemu-img info -f cow 1255869863.cow
qemu-img: Could not open '1255869863.cow'
$
